Output 31b401ac86b24dd48da6da31156b640f398cbdbbf46746282d44ea1e7e34c1ea:6

value
56753688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90149824720d4a3073b056c92b20330f992ce4a4 OP_EQUAL
address
MM2zCyHWow5rG28TwzD31eGgChcgHvFa5o
transaction
31b401ac86b24dd48da6da31156b640f398cbdbbf46746282d44ea1e7e34c1ea
spent
true